When we refer to off-exchange strategies, we're only talking about major medical protection the plans to which ACA policies use. A variety of "excepted benefit" strategies (such as short-term health insurance coverage) are also sold outside the exchanges in the majority of states, and are exempt from ACA guidelines. However our conversation of off-exchange strategies just refers to ACA-compliant plans offered outside the exchanges.
And the same open enrollment window November 1 to December 15 in most states uses no matter whether the strategy is offered in the exchange our outside the exchange. But the ACA's premium subsidies and cost-sharing reductions are just offered if you purchase a strategy in the exchange. If you purchase the specific same strategy directly from the insurer (ie, off-exchange), you'll need to pay full rate, there will be no cost-sharing decreases offered, and you won't have an option to declare the premium tax credit when you submit your income tax return the list below year.

If your present health insurance policy is not grandfathered however was in result prior to 2014, your strategy is considered a transitional health plan or "grandmothered policy." These strategies are not completely ACA-compliant, and were purchased in between March 23, 2010 when the ACA was signed into law and completion of 2013.

Transitional health insurance were initially slated to end in 2014. But extensions have been approved by the federal government every year, permitting these plans to remain in force if the state agrees and if the insurance provider still wishes to restore the strategies. The newest extension enables transitional health insurance to renew up until October 1, 2021, and stay in force till completion of 2021.
( In the remaining states, these plans were either needed to end or insurance companies willingly ended them and replaced them with ACA-compliant protection.) If you're registered in a transitional strategy and your insurance company is offering renewal for 2021, you have the option to keep your prepare for another year. However it's certainly in your benefit to thoroughly compare your plan with the new options that are offered in the ACA-compliant market for 2021.
( Premium subsidies for 2021 are readily available for a bachelor with an income up to $51,040. In 2014, a single person could only qualify for subsidies with an income of as much as $45,960; as the poverty level increases each year, so does the earnings cap for aid eligibility.) And the ACA-compliant strategies readily available now are most likely to provide more robust protection including all of the important health benefits than the strategy you purchased prior to 2014.

In a lot of states, open enrollment for 2021 protection will range from November 1 to December 15, 2020, with all strategies efficient January 1, 2021. Open enrollment for 2021 protection ended on December 15, 2020 in a lot of states. California, Colorado, and Washington, DC, have actually permanently extended open enrollment. State-run exchanges have versatility to make OEP longer.

And the majority of the other totally state-run exchanges have chosen to extend the open registration period for 2021 coverage, suggesting it will continue past December 15. Outside of open enrollment, strategy changes and new enrollments are only possible for individuals who experience a qualifying occasion. Native Americans and Alaska Natives can enlist year-round in strategies offered in the exchange.

California's registration schedule has actually varied in previous years, however this three-month window, from the beginning of November through completion of January, will be the irreversible registration window going forward. Colorado's Department of Insurance has likewise completely extended open enrollment. The state completed guidelines in late 2018 that require a yearly special registration duration, ranging from December 16 to January 15, that is included to completion of open registration each year.
